Hello I’m looking to make my own set of lights, what I would like to know is what the little white connector is called so I can buy some for my diy kit.

I'm talking about the item I have put in the red circle dose anyone know what these are called ?

Am I right in thinking these are the same type/size as the ones you find on some of the old CDROM - Sound Card cables, the ones you would use to connect the back of a cdrom drive to the PCI sound card. ?

loll, well I’ve just found the exact same ones.

They are a standard 1.25mm Connector VERTICAL HDR 4 Port made by:
- Molex – Manufacturer Part #: 51021-0400

You also need the Female Crimp Terminals by:
- Molex – Manufacturer Part #: 50058-8000

So yea they are NOT exclusive parts at all, Anyone needing the website details to order the above just get in contact and I can give you that information for UK and also US based vender’s.
